How many of you have ever had your house tested for Black Mold or even mold of any kind.
I just had mine done and found out that I have stage one mold in my attic.
One of the problems was found to be that during construction all of the soffits had been blocked by insulation, no air circulation. I had a solar fan installed 10 years but it could no preform as designed because of the blocked soffits. The cooling ducts were leaking and condensation occurred.
